A lot of people have asked about 3, and Microsoft has been quiet about everything. Some of the leads on the game have actually moved on to other …

Press here: Crackdown 3 for more similar videos

Tags: ,

Watch more:

Leave a Reply

Your email address will not be published. Required fields are marked *